SIOUX FALLS, S.D. (AP) - Sioux Falls police say illegal drugs were involved in a weekend incident in which a man was arrested for fatally shooting his brother.
Twenty-seven-year-old Jeremy Eischens is charged with manslaughter and drug counts in the incident about 3:30 a.m. Saturday in which 24-year-old Brandon Eischens was shot twice in the upper torso and died. It wasn’t immediately clear if he had an attorney. A home telephone listing couldn’t be found.
Police say Brandon Eischens went to his brother’s apartment to give him vehicle keys so his brother could make a drug run to Denver. Details of how the shooting happened weren’t immediately released, but Police Lt. Mike Colwill said it involved “reckless use” of a gun.
Authorities say they found drugs and $29,000 in cash in the apartment.
